Price drivers

What changes the price in Elk Grove

Elk Grove is a large market, so there are usually several contractors bidding, which tends to compress routine pricing and widen the spread on emergency call-outs.

  1. 01

    Number of holes in the deck and whether the new fixture matches

  2. 02

    Access under the cabinet

  3. 03

    Repair of the existing valve versus full fixture replacement

  4. 04

    Whether replacement parts are still available for the brand and model

Before you sign

What to ask a Elk Grove contractor first

  1. 01

    If a homeowner-supplied faucet is used, who carries responsibility for missing parts, poor castings or a later warranty claim?

  2. 02

    Does the visit also cover the P-trap, tailpiece and basket strainer, since leaks below the bowl are often mistaken for faucet drips?

  3. 03

    Which valve type is fitted — cartridge, ball, ceramic disc or compression — and are matching parts still made for that model?

Faucet & Sink in Elk Grove — common questions

Is a dripping faucet actually worth fixing?

Yes — a steady drip wastes a meaningful volume over a year, and the same worn seat that drips is usually also scoring the valve body. Catching it early keeps it a cartridge replacement instead of a fixture replacement.

Why is water pressure low at only one faucet?

A single fixture usually means a clogged aerator or a partially closed or failing angle stop, not a house-wide pressure problem. Aerator cleaning is the first thing to rule out.

Can I supply my own faucet?

Many contractors will install an owner-supplied fixture but will not warrant the fixture itself. Ask how it affects the labor warranty before buying.

Do I need a permit for plumbing work in Elk Grove?

Permit requirements around Elk Grove are set locally rather than statewide. As a rule, water heater replacement, gas work, sewer laterals and repiping are permitted work, while a like-for-like faucet or disposal swap usually is not. A licensed contractor pulls the permit — if one offers to skip it, that is the signal to stop.

Are night and weekend calls handled differently in Elk Grove?

Requests route around the clock, but most contractors price after-hours work differently. Ask for the after-hours rate and a committed arrival window before agreeing to a dispatch.

What information speeds up a faucet & sink callback?

Three things: where the water or problem is showing, whether the supply is shut off, and the property type — slab, crawl space or basement. With those, a pro covering Elk Grove can triage the urgency and bring the right parts.
